Great public transportation with a special week ticket for tourists. Love the harbor, canals, St. Michaelis church and the Reeperbahn. I also went to a beach along the Elbe to swim in the river. The Summer Dom was also going on (fun fair).

Go to the Movie mini golf, super fun for a group. Take the lift up to the top of the spire of the St. Nikolai Memorial and visit the exhibition beneath, very humbling. Frau Muller is a good pub to visit great atmosphere.
